Rhine was employed as a design engineer most of his life, including at VM Corporation and Whirlpool Corporation in Michigan, and Long Manufacturing and TRW in North Carolina. Rhine and his wife Leona served as educational missionaries, sponsored by the Presbyterian Church-U.S., in Haiti and Jamaica for 14 years.   In Haiti, Rhine worked with the Episcopal Church building and administrating vocational education training schools, and large and small scale agricultural projects throughout the country, as well as serving as administrator of Hospital St. Croix in Leogane.  Beginning in the mid-1970s, these schools graduated over 2000 students each year.   

Rhine was a member of St. Paul’s Episcopal Church, the American Society of Agricultural Engineers (ASAE), and was a former President of the Lakeshore Jaycees. In his free time, Rhine enjoyed woodworking and carving duck decoys.
